Output 58c8f5fee1c982d039f61baaf3e3eb7b3c06c117b441da9c947269eb169f8919:1

value
676577
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85613c195dbc812ef137595fa6a369ad59939bd5 OP_EQUALVERIFY OP_CHECKSIG
address
1DAFMWBcNyBWHW44VHLkBCsvBHwRPWtWjS
transaction
58c8f5fee1c982d039f61baaf3e3eb7b3c06c117b441da9c947269eb169f8919
spent
true